Christian Dior Couture seeks an Europe Safety & Security Manager in Paris to oversee retail security across European boutiques.

Role & Responsibilities

  • Develop security concepts for boutique projects in collaboration with the Store Planning Division, supervising all security-related works across European boutiques from risk analysis through operational implementation
  • Ensure compliance with applicable legislation and regulations regarding protection of assets and personnel
  • Manage relationships with security service providers, including tender processes, contract negotiation, budget oversight, and performance monitoring
  • Maintain and oversee passive technical protection systems and security devices across all facilities
  • Implement and continuously optimize retail security and safety procedures across the European network
  • Promote and drive a security culture among retail personnel through dedicated training initiatives
  • Conduct risk analysis studies and develop mitigation and vulnerability treatment plans for boutiques
  • Define and supervise security arrangements for brand events and special occasions
  • Monitor technological and regulatory developments in the security domain

Qualifications

  • Minimum 5 years of professional experience in safety and security, preferably within the luxury sector
  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ent (Bac +4/5) in law, security management, or related field
  • CERIC (Certificat d'Etudes Réglementaires, d'Instruction et de Compétences) technical certification
  • Fluent English, both written and oral
  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int)
